Tyler, TX – The NMMI Broncos (3-5, 1-5) garnered their first SWJCFC win of the season against the Tyler JC Apaches (5-3, 3-3) Saturday afternoon in Tyler 17-14.
KILGORE, TEXAS - The Bronco football team shutout Kilgore College in the second half, but couldn’t overcome a 17-point halftime deficit, dropping a conference game on the road to the Rangers, 17-15.

The Bronco defense played their best game of the season, helping the NMMI offense overcome a slow start, downing Arkansas Baptist 35-6 in Saturday’s neutral site game in Wichita Falls, TX.
The expression says that while offense wins games, defense wins championships – which could bode well for this year’s 2017 Bronco football team.
After sending 27 graduates on to play at four- schools last year — including standout quarterback Jordan Ta’amu who finished second in the NJCAA for TD passes and third in the nation for passing yardage last season before signing to play for Ole Miss — this year’s sophomore class is heavy on defense.
COLORADO SPRINGS — On the road in Colorado Springs, the Bronco football team outlasted their Husky opponents, surviving a 19-point Air Force Prep rally in the second and third quarters to win their season opener, 41-26.
